Devi Mahatmya: A Hymn to the Divine Feminine

The Devi Mahatmya, dubbed as the Durga Saptashati, is an ancient Hindu scripture that extols the majesty of the Supreme Goddess. It narrates the exalted tales of Devi in her various manifestations, showcasing her awe-inspiring strength and compassion. Through captivating accounts, the text underscores the fundamental role of Devi in the cosmic order, establishing her as the ultimate source of existence.

Unveiling the Spirit of Navratri: Honoring Feminine Power

Navratri, a vibrant nine-night festival, is honored across India with immense enthusiasm. It's a occasion dedicated to paying homage to the sacred feminine energy, embodied in the various forms of Goddess Durga.

Throughout these nine nights, community centers come alive with joyful decorations and time-honored rituals. Devotees participate in singing, offering their gratitude to the Goddess.

The essence of Navratri lies in acknowledging the grace of the feminine principle, which embodies creation, protection. It's a reminder that the feminine energy is integral to our well-being.
